Warning Signs Your Home Needs a Wi-Fi Mesh Network Setup
When your network is struggling, it leaves clear clues that a standard router is no longer sufficient. You might notice these common symptoms disrupting your daily routine:
* Complete loss of signal in specific rooms or detached structures. * Constant buffering during streaming or pixelated video calls. * Smart home devices repeatedly going offline or failing to respond. * Inability to connect to the network from outdoor patios or pool areas. * The need to manually restart your router multiple times a week.
Recognizing these symptoms early can save you hours of frustrating troubleshooting. Here is a closer look at what these warning signs mean for your home.
Persistent Wi-Fi Dead Zones
You constantly lose connection in specific areas like the master suite, a detached office, or out by the pool. Your phone or laptop shows no signal, or the signal is extremely weak, even though your main internet connection is perfectly fine. This means your current Wi-Fi router lacks the range or signal strength to cover the entire footprint of your property.
Ignoring these dead zones makes entire sections of your home unusable for internet-dependent activities. It also hinders smart device functionality in those spaces, essentially cutting off parts of your property from the modern conveniences you rely on. You deserve to use every room in your house without worrying about losing your connection.
Slow Internet Speeds and Constant Buffering
Despite paying your provider for a premium high-speed internet plan, your streaming services frequently buffer and video calls pixelate or drop. You might also notice web pages loading slowly, particularly when multiple family members are using devices at the same time. This indicates your network is struggling to handle the bandwidth demands of your devices, or there is significant signal degradation causing reduced effective speeds.
Living with this leads to a frustrating digital experience and severely impacts productivity for remote work. It also prevents you from fully enjoying high-definition entertainment or utilizing your smart home's full potential. A proper setup ensures you actually get the speeds you pay for from your internet service provider.
Smart Home Devices Frequently Disconnecting
Your smart thermostat goes offline, security cameras stop recording, smart lighting fails to respond, or your video doorbell lags. You constantly have to reset devices or check their connection status through various mobile apps. These devices rely entirely on a stable Wi-Fi connection to function properly and communicate with your network.
Frequent disconnections indicate an unreliable network, often due to poor signal strength or a single router being overwhelmed by too many requests. This compromises your home's security, energy efficiency, and the convenience you invested in. It essentially turns sophisticated smart devices into frustratingly dumb ones that require constant manual intervention.
Inconsistent Outdoor Wi-Fi Coverage
You cannot get a reliable Wi-Fi signal on your patio, in your garden, or near your outdoor entertainment areas. This makes it difficult to use outdoor smart speakers, stream music, or even just browse the internet while enjoying your Montecito property. Standard indoor Wi-Fi signals are simply not designed to penetrate thick exterior walls or cover extensive outdoor areas.
When you ignore this, you miss out on the full enjoyment and utility of your outdoor living spaces. Furthermore, any outdoor smart devices like smart irrigation controllers or exterior security cameras may fail to function reliably. This leaves blind spots in your property management and limits how you interact with your landscape.
Frequent Router Reboots
You find yourself regularly unplugging and replugging your router to restore or improve your Wi-Fi connection. Sometimes you might have to do this multiple times a week just to keep your household online. Your existing router is likely struggling to keep up with the demands of your home's size and the sheer number of connected devices.
This leads to system crashes or instability that only a hard reset temporarily fixes. Relying on constant reboots is a temporary bandage that does not address the underlying problem. It leads to ongoing frustration and potential wear on your networking equipment over time.
What is Causing Your Wi-Fi Problems?
Understanding why your network is failing is the first step toward a permanent solution. Several common factors can cripple a standard wireless setup, especially in larger properties. We see these specific issues frequently when diagnosing poor connectivity.
Large Home Square Footage and Complex Layouts
A single Wi-Fi router is designed to cover a specific, limited area effectively. In a sprawling Montecito home, you often have extensive square footage, multiple stories, and separate structures like guest houses or detached offices. A single router simply cannot project a strong, stable signal across such a vast and varied footprint.
The physical distance alone causes the wireless signal to degrade significantly before it reaches the furthest corners of your property. A Wi-Fi mesh network setup solves this by using multiple interconnected access points, or nodes. These nodes work together to create a unified, strong network that covers every inch of your space without dropping the signal as you move around.
Signal Obstructions from Building Materials
Wi-Fi signals can be weakened or completely blocked by dense building materials like stucco, stone, brick, concrete, and thick plaster walls. Interior elements like large appliances, metal ductwork, and dense custom cabinetry can also cause severe interference. Many homes in this area utilize robust construction materials that are excellent for insulation and aesthetics but notoriously bad for Wi-Fi signal penetration.
When a wireless signal hits these dense materials, it bounces or absorbs rather than passing through to your devices. Strategic placement of mesh nodes can circumvent these physical barriers entirely. We carefully map out these obstacles to ensure the signal reaches areas that were previously dead zones.
Overwhelmed by Numerous Connected Devices
Modern households are filled with smart devices, from televisions and gaming consoles to smart thermostats, security cameras, smart lighting, and personal phones. A traditional router can only handle a finite number of simultaneous connections efficiently before its performance severely degrades. The high adoption rate of smart home technology means your network is likely under constant, heavy load throughout the day and night.
When too many devices demand bandwidth simultaneously, the router creates a bottleneck, slowing down the connection for everything on the network. Mesh networks are specifically designed to handle a much higher volume of connected devices simultaneously. They distribute the load intelligently across multiple nodes, ensuring each device gets the bandwidth it needs without dragging down the rest of the house.
Outdated Router Technology
Older routers simply are not built to meet the demands of today's gigabit internet speeds or high-bandwidth applications like 4K streaming. They use older wireless standards and often have less powerful processors and weaker internal antennas. Even well-maintained properties might have networking equipment that has not kept pace with rapidly evolving technology.
When you rely on aging hardware, you are artificially limiting the internet speeds you already pay for from your provider. Upgrading to a modern Wi-Fi mesh network setup provides the latest technology, significantly faster speeds, and much more robust handling of network traffic. This ensures your home is ready for both current devices and future smart home additions.
